Shoda Shoyu Stadium Gunma
Shoda Shoyu Stadium Gunma is a multi-purpose stadium in Maebashi, Japan. It is currently used mostly for football matches. Sponsored by soy sauce maker Shoda Shoyu, which has its headquarters in nearby Tatebayashi, the stadium serves as a home ground of Thespa Gunma.Photo: Wikimedia, Public domain.

Yoshioka
Town
Photo: TANAKA Juuyoh (田中十洋), CC BY 2.0.
Yoshioka is a town located in Gunma Prefecture, Japan. As of 1 September 2020, the town had an estimated population of 21,749 in 8,311 households, and a population density of 1100 persons per km2. The total area of the town is 20.46 square kilometres. Yoshioka is situated 6 km northwest of Shoda Shoyu Stadium Gunma.
Shinto
Village
Photo: Qurren,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Shintō is a village located in Gunma Prefecture, Japan. As of 31 August 2020, the village had an estimated population of 15,653 in 5,942 households, and a population density of 520 persons per km2. The total area of the village is 27.92 square kilometres. Shinto is situated 8 km west of Shoda Shoyu Stadium Gunma.
